Abstract
A battery internal short-circuit detecting device has: a battery temperature detection unit for detecting a battery temperature Tr; an ambient temperature detection unit for detecting an ambient temperature Te; an average heating value detection unit for detecting an average value Pav of battery heating values per predetermined first period ΔW1, which are generated by discharging or charging the battery; a battery temperature estimation unit for obtaining a battery temperature Tp estimated to be reached after a lapse of a predetermined second period ΔW2 since the detection of the average value Pav of the heating values, based on the average value Pav of the heating values and the ambient temperature Te; and an internal short-circuit determination unit for determining that an internal short circuit has occurred when the actual battery temperature Tr after the lapse of the second period ΔW2 is equal to or greater than the sum of the estimated battery temperature Tp and a predetermined coefficient α.
